Get started2 Alan Court is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Thornton, Bradford, Bradford (BD13 3JU). It has a recorded floor area of 43 m² (around 465 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band A. At 43 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across the building (43–66 m²). Other recorded features include notable views. The latest certificate (February 2012) shows a C (score 76), near the top of the C band. The latest certificate is from February 2012,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Sale prices here have outpaced Bradford HPI: 2.6%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£99,000 sits 58.4% above the 2014 sale of £62,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£134/sq ft) was about 26.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 43 m² it sits well below the postcode median (62 m² across 9 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Last changed hands 12 years ago, in November 2014.
